American bebop trumpeter (1923–1950), influential in late-1940s recordings; noted for melodic phrasing, strong attack and harmonic sophistication. Worked with Tadd Dameron, Bud Powell and Billy Eckstine; died at 26.

Born October 24, 1923; died July 6, 1950. Birth name Theodore Navarro. Key collaborator with Tadd Dameron and featured in bands led by Billy Eckstine and Bud Powell. Recorded for labels including Blue Note, Capitol and Savoy. Considered an important bebop trumpeter and a precursor to hard bop.
